Singer And YouTube Star Lil Bo Weep Dies At Age 22
The cause of her death isn’t given.
Singer Lil Bo Weep, whose real name is Winona Lisa Green, has been battling depression, trauma, PTSFD, and drug addiction. On Instagram last week [her final post on social media platform], the YouTuber Star opened up about her struggles and revealed she had been crying all days over the loss of her child.

In the post’s caption, the artist said she grew up with a severe eating disorder and had been taking medication to help her avoid any psychosis from my CPTSD.
“Around this time last year I lost my child and I would like to do something in remembrance of her preferably with some flowers or on the beach and spend the day just mourning. I would really appreciate if anyone in Adelaide would be kind enough to do that for me and with me, so please reach out. Thank You,” she said.
Reportedly, Lil Bo Weep started releasing music in 2015 and has since garnered over 36,500 followers on SoundCloud. She equally has 125K subscribers on her YouTube channel.
Sadly, the Australian has passed away on March 5th, and her father Mathew Schofield confirmed it in a post on Facebook.

While the cause of her death remains unknown, Mathew wrote: “This weekend we lost the fight for my daughter’s life against depression, trauma, PTSD and drug addiction that we have been fighting since we got her back from America through emergency repatriation [Department of Foreign Affairs] but broken. She fought hard against her demons as we all did side by side next to her and picking up the broken pieces over and over again but she could not fight anymore and we lost her.”
“As her dad I am proud of her beyond words as she is my hero, my daughter and my best friend that I love so much.”
“She’s no longer hurting now with the universe wanting their angel back. A big part of me is lost at the moment but I ask respectfully that my close friends try not to ring me until I get some way through this. ALWAYS IN MY HEART. I LOVE MY WINNIE. Lil Bo Weep.” Mathew’s tribute concluded.
So far, Mathew’s post on Facebook has garnered over 5.8K reactions, including 4.6K shares and 146 comments. Lisa’s fans have equally expressed their condolence on Twitter.
